Recognizing Home Window Scores and Performance
To better understand home window ratings and performance, it is very important to familiarize yourself with the various efficiency metrics. These metrics help you review the energy efficiency of windows and make educated choices when selecting the appropriate ones for your home.One of the crucial metrics is the U-factor. This measures exactly how well a home window avoids warmth from escaping your home. The reduced the U-factor, the better the home window's insulation homes. Another crucial metric is the Solar Heat Gain Coefficient (SHGC), which suggests just how much solar heat is transferred through the window. A reduced SHGC indicates much less heat enters your home, which is particularly helpful in hot environments.
Furthermore, you need to take notice of the Noticeable Passage (VT) ranking. This gauges just how much noticeable light passes with the home window. A greater VT rating implies even more all-natural light enters your home, decreasing the need for synthetic lights.
Last but not least, look for windows with a high Air Leak (AL) ranking. This indicates just how much air seeps through the home window. Posey Home Improvements Inc.. Lower AL scores imply much less air seepage, causing improved energy effectiveness and comfort
Selecting the Right Window Frame Material
When selecting the right window structure product, it is necessary to take into consideration variables such as toughness, maintenance, and appearances. You desire a home window framework material that will certainly last for several years ahead without needing excessive upkeep. Vinyl frames are a popular selection as a result of their reduced maintenance requirements and outstanding resilience. They are resistant to rot, corrosion, and fading, making them optimal for any type of climate. One more option is aluminum frameworks, which are strong, lightweight, and additionally reduced maintenance. Nevertheless, they may not be as energy-efficient as plastic frameworks. If you prefer an even more typical appearance, timber frames are a classic choice. They are recognized for their appeal and beauty, however they do need regular upkeep to avoid deteriorating and deforming. Fiberglass frameworks are one more alternative to take into consideration. They are extremely sturdy, reduced upkeep, and deal excellent thermal efficiency. Eventually, your choice of home window framework product will depend on your individual choices, budget plan, and the environment in which you live.
